Interesting...where abouts (and how) would one go to gather oysters? Would it be safe for kids though?




Not much to it --- just wear old shoes or boats, rubber gloves, take a bucket for your haul and head to a marshy area...there are a number of beds that you can harvest from down around Murrells Inlet and the Pawleys Island area....I do think you have to have some type of license :





';A South Carolina Marine Recreational Fisheries Stamp (Adobe PDF) is required for recreational harvesting. There is a harvesting limit of two bushels of oysters or one-half bushel of clams, or both, per person, per day from authorized harvesting areas. Shellfish culture permits cannot be harvested without being in possession of written permission from the permit holder. ';





But it is alot of fun, and the fresh oysters are wonderful! I think they also do a program on Oysters and Crabbing at Huntington Beach State Park (southcarolinaparks.com/park-finder/…1020.aspx)
